//! Cargo bench integration: parse Criterion and libtest bench output into RunReceipts.
//!
//! This module provides:
//! - Criterion JSON parsing (`target/criterion/{bench}/new/estimates.json`)
//! - Libtest bench output parsing (`test ... bench: NNN ns/iter (+/- NNN)`)
//! - A use-case struct that runs `cargo bench` and produces a `RunReceipt`

use crate::app::Clock;
use crate::domain::compute_stats;
use perfgate_types::{BenchMeta, HostInfo, RUN_SCHEMA_V1, RunMeta, RunReceipt, Sample, ToolInfo};
use std::path::{Path, PathBuf};

/// A single benchmark result parsed from Criterion or libtest output.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q)]
pub struct ParsedBenchmark {
    /// Benchmark name (e.g., "my_group/my_bench")
    pub name: String,
    /// Estimated time per iteration in nanoseconds
    pub estimate_ns: f64,
    /// Standard error or deviation in nanoseconds (if available)
    pub error_ns: Option<f64>,
    /// Source format that produced this result
    pub source: BenchSource,
}

/// Which benchmark framework produced the result.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ub enum BenchSource {
    Criterion,
    Libtest,
}

/// Criterion's `estimates.json` structure (subset).
#[derive(Debug, serde::Deserialize)]
pub struct CriterionEstimates {
    pub mean: Option<CriterionEstimate>,
    pub median: Option<CriterionEstimate>,
    pub slope: Option<CriterionEstimate>,
}

#[derive(Debug, serde::Deserialize)]
pub struct CriterionEstimate {
    /// Confidence interval
    pub confidence_interval: CriterionConfidenceInterval,
    /// Point estimate in nanoseconds
    pub point_estimate: f64,
    /// Standard error in nanoseconds
    pub standard_error: f64,
}

#[derive(Debug, serde::Deserialize)]
pub struct CriterionConfidenceInterval {
    pub confidence_level: f64,
    pub lower_bound: f64,
    pub upper_bound: f64,
}

/// Request for the cargo bench use case.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Default)]
pub struct CargoBenchRequest {
    /// Specific bench target name (--bench <name>)
    pub bench_target: Option<String>,
    /// Extra args to pass to `cargo bench` (after --)
    pub extra_args: Vec<String>,
    /// Output path for the run receipt
    pub out: Option<PathBuf>,
    /// Optional baseline to compare against
    pub compare_baseline: Option<PathBuf>,
    /// Pretty-print JSON output
    pub pretty: bool,
    /// Override the target directory (default: auto-detect)
    pub target_dir: Option<PathBuf>,
    /// Include hostname hash in host fingerprint
    pub include_hostname_hash: bool,
}

/// Outcome from the cargo bench use case.
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
pub struct CargoBenchOutcome {
    /// One RunReceipt per discovered benchmark
    pub receipts: Vec<RunReceipt>,
    /// Detection mode used
    pub source: BenchSource,
    /// Total benchmarks discovered
    pub bench_count: usize,
}

//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
// Criterion parsing
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------

/// Scan `target/criterion/` for benchmark results and parse them.
///
/// Criterion stores results in:
///   `target/criterion/{group}/{bench}/new/estimates.json`
/// or for ungrouped benches:
///   `target/criterion/{bench}/new/estimates.json`
pub fn scan_criterion_dir(criterion_dir: &Path) -> anyhow::Result<Vec<ParsedBenchmark>> {
    let mut results = Vec::new();
    scan_criterion_recursive(criterion_dir, criterion_dir, &mut results)?;
    results.sort_by(|a, b| a.name.cmp(&b.name));
    Ok(results)
}

fn scan_criterion_recursive(
    base_dir: &Path,
    current_dir: &Path,
    results: &mut Vec<ParsedBenchmark>,
) -> anyhow::Result<()> {
    let estimates_path = current_dir.join("new").join("estimates.json");
    if estimates_path.is_file() {
        let relative = current_dir
            .strip_prefix(base_dir)
            .unwrap_or(current_dir)
            .to_string_lossy()
            .replace('\\', "/");

        if let Ok(parsed) = parse_criterion_estimates(&estimates_path) {
            results.push(ParsedBenchmark {
                name: relative,
                estimate_ns: parsed.estimate_ns,
                error_ns: parsed.error_ns,
                source: BenchSource::Criterion,
            });
        }
        return Ok(());
    }

    if current_dir.is_dir() {
        let entries = std::fs::read_dir(current_dir)?;
        for entry in entries {
            let entry = entry?;
            let path = entry.path();
            if path.is_dir() {
                // Skip internal criterion dirs
                let name = entry.file_name();
                let name_str = name.to_string_lossy();
                if name_str == "report" || name_str.starts_with('.') {
                    continue;
                }
                scan_criterion_recursive(base_dir, &path, results)?;
            }
        }
    }

    Ok(())
}

struct ParsedEstimate {
    estimate_ns: f64,
    error_ns: Option<f64>,
}

fn parse_criterion_estimates(path: &Path) -> anyhow::Result<ParsedEstimate> {
    let content = std::fs::read_to_string(path)?;
    let estimates: CriterionEstimates = serde_json::from_str(&content)?;

    // Prefer slope > mean > median (slope is the per-iteration estimate from regression)
    let est = estimates
        .slope
        .as_ref()
        .or(estimates.mean.as_ref())
        .or(estimates.median.as_ref())
        .ok_or_else(|| anyhow::anyhow!("no estimate found in {}", path.display()))?;

    Ok(ParsedEstimate {
        estimate_ns: est.point_estimate,
        error_ns: Some(est.standard_error),
    })
}

//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
// Libtest parsing
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------

/// Parse libtest bench output lines.
///
/// Format: `test bench_name ... bench:       NNN ns/iter (+/- NNN)`
pub fn parse_libtest_output(output: &str) -> Vec<ParsedBenchmark> {
    let mut results = Vec::new();

    for line in output.lines() {
        if let Some(parsed) = parse_libtest_line(line) {
            results.push(parsed);
        }
    }

    results.sort_by(|a, b| a.name.cmp(&b.name));
    results
}

fn parse_libtest_line(line: &str) -> Option<ParsedBenchmark> {
    // Pattern: test <name> ... bench:  <number> ns/iter (+/- <number>)
    let line = line.trim();
    if !line.starts_with("test ") {
        return None;
    }

    let rest = &line["test ".len()..];

    // Find "... bench:" separator
    let bench_marker = "... bench:";
    let bench_idx = rest.find(bench_marker)?;
    let name = rest[..bench_idx].trim().to_string();
    let after_bench = &rest[bench_idx + bench_marker.len()..];

    // Parse: "       NNN ns/iter (+/- NNN)"
    let after_bench = after_bench.trim();

    // Extract the number before "ns/iter"
    let ns_iter_idx = after_bench.find("ns/iter")?;
    let ns_str = after_bench[..ns_iter_idx].trim().replace(',', "");
    let estimate_ns: f64 = ns_str.parse().ok()?;

    // Extract the +/- value
    let error_ns = if let Some(paren_start) = after_bench.find("(+/- ") {
        let after_paren = &after_bench[paren_start + "(+/- ".len()..];
        if let Some(paren_end) = after_paren.find(')') {
            let error_str = after_paren[..paren_end].trim().replace(',', "");
            error_str.parse().ok()
        } else {
            None
        }
    } else {
        None
    };

    Some(ParsedBenchmark {
        name,
        estimate_ns,
        error_ns,
        source: BenchSource::Libtest,
    })
}

//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
// Detect which framework was used
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------

/// Detect whether Criterion results are available by checking for a recent
/// `target/criterion/` directory with `estimates.json` files.
pub fn detect_criterion(target_dir: &Path) -> bool {
    let criterion_dir = target_dir.join("criterion");
    if !criterion_dir.is_dir() {
        return false;
    }
    // Check if any estimates.json exists
    has_estimates_json(&criterion_dir)
}

fn has_estimates_json(dir: &Path) -> bool {
    let estimates = dir.join("new").join("estimates.json");
    if estimates.is_file() {
        return true;
    }
    if let Ok(entries) = std::fs::read_dir(dir) {
        for entry in entries.flatten() {
            let path = entry.path();
            if path.is_dir() {
                let name = entry.file_name();
                let name_str = name.to_string_lossy();
                if name_str != "report" && !name_str.starts_with('.') && has_estimates_json(&path) {
                    return true;
                }
            }
        }
    }
    false
}

//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
// Convert parsed benchmarks to RunReceipts
// ---------------------------------------------------------------------------

/// Convert a list of parsed benchmarks into a single RunReceipt with
/// one "sample" per benchmark (since Criterion/libtest already aggregate).
pub fn benchmarks_to_receipt(
    benchmarks: &[ParsedBenchmark],
    name: &str,
    tool: &ToolInfo,
    host: &HostInfo,
    clock: &dyn Clock,
    command: &[String],
) -> anyhow::Result<RunReceipt> {
    if benchmarks.is_empty() {
        anyhow::bail!("no benchmarks found");
    }

    let run_id = uuid::Uuid::new_v4().to_string();
    let started_at = clock.now_rfc3339();

    // For the receipt, we create synthetic samples from the parsed data.
    // Each benchmark's estimate_ns is converted to wall_ms.
    let mut samples: Vec<Sample> = Vec::new();

    for bench in benchmarks {
        let wall_ms = (bench.estimate_ns / 1_000_000.0).round().max(1.0) as u64;
        samples.push(Sample {
            wall_ms,
            exit_code: 0,
            warmup: false,
            timed_out: false,
            cpu_ms: None,
            page_faults: None,
            ctx_switches: None,
            max_rss_kb: None,
            io_read_bytes: None,
            io_write_bytes: None,
            network_packets: None,
            energy_uj: None,
            binary_bytes: None,
            stdout: None,
            stderr: None,
        });
    }

    let stats = compute_stats(&samples, None)?;
    let ended_at = clock.now_rfc3339();

    Ok(RunReceipt {
        schema: RUN_SCHEMA_V1.to_string(),
        tool: tool.clone(),
        run: RunMeta {
            id: run_id,
            started_at,
            ended_at,
            host: host.clone(),
        },
        bench: BenchMeta {
            name: name.to_string(),
            cwd: None,
            command: command.to_vec(),
            repeat: benchmarks.len() as u32,
            warmup: 0,
            work_units: None,
            timeout_ms: None,
        },
        samples,
        stats,
    })
}

/// Convert each parsed benchmark into its own RunReceipt (one receipt per benchmark).
pub fn benchmarks_to_individual_receipts(
    benchmarks: &[ParsedBenchmark],
    tool: &ToolInfo,
    host: &HostInfo,
    clock: &dyn Clock,
    command: &[String],
) -> anyhow::Result<Vec<RunReceipt>> {
    let mut receipts = Vec::new();

    for bench in benchmarks {
        let wall_ms = (bench.estimate_ns / 1_000_000.0).round().max(1.0) as u64;

        let sample = Sample {
            wall_ms,
            exit_code: 0,
            warmup: false,
            timed_out: false,
            cpu_ms: None,
            page_faults: None,
            ctx_switches: None,
            max_rss_kb: None,
            io_read_bytes: None,
            io_write_bytes: None,
            network_packets: None,
            energy_uj: None,
            binary_bytes: None,
            stdout: None,
            stderr: None,
        };

        let run_id = uuid::Uuid::new_v4().to_string();
        let ts = clock.now_rfc3339();
        let stats = compute_stats(std::slice::from_ref(&sample), None)?;

        receipts.push(RunReceipt {
            schema: RUN_SCHEMA_V1.to_string(),
            tool: tool.clone(),
            run: RunMeta {
                id: run_id,
                started_at: ts.clone(),
                ended_at: ts,
                host: host.clone(),
            },
            bench: BenchMeta {
                name: bench.name.clone(),
                cwd: None,
                command: command.to_vec(),
                repeat: 1,
                warmup: 0,
                work_units: None,
                timeout_ms: None,
            },
            samples: vec![sample],
            stats,
        });
    }

    Ok(receipts)
}

/// Build the `cargo bench` command line.
pub fn build_cargo_bench_command(bench_target: Option<&str>, extra_args: &[String]) -> Vec<String> {
    let mut cmd = vec!["cargo".to_string(), "bench".to_string()];

    if let Some(target) = bench_target {
        cmd.push("--bench".to_string());
        cmd.push(target.to_string());
    }

    if !extra_args.is_empty() {
        cmd.push("--".to_string());
        cmd.extend(extra_args.iter().cloned());
    }

    cmd
}

/// Auto-detect the cargo target directory.
pub fn detect_target_dir() -> PathBuf {
    // Check CARGO_TARGET_DIR first
    if let Ok(dir) = std::env::var("CARGO_TARGET_DIR") {
        return PathBuf::from(dir);
    }

    // Default to ./target
    PathBuf::from("target")
}
